“写不出的时候不硬写。”——鲁迅《二心集·答北斗杂志社问》
有时感觉吧,“拖延症”是程序人必备的素养。我试过三、四个月一行代码都憋不出,比便秘还难受。期间一直在反复斟酌犹豫考虑迟疑……然而,就是没有办法开始写下第一段代码。
有时一大早打开电脑,兴冲冲发下“毒誓”:
“今天自我感觉状态非常好,一定能开始这项工程啦!——要不然,简直就猪狗不如!”
结果一直等到傍晚关电脑时,这才发觉:
一整天除了看看八卦、下载几个莫名其妙的东西,其他的啥也没干;基本上是坐实了“猪狗不如”的坏名堂。
总是要等到某一天,实在没脸拖下去啦,这才灵光一闪,劈里啪啦,三下五除二,两三周之内赶出初稿。
记得科比说过,这叫作“ZONE”。
人一定要进入ZONE,才能够物我两忘,思如泉涌,如有神助。
有点儿神道了。
不过确实如此。
憋不出代码的时候,虽说啥也干不了,其实脑袋瓜子倒也没闲着。
往往一个人散步时,拈花一笑,突然就能想出一个“古德埃第尔”,轻轻松松解决掉一个困扰多时的局部难题。
几十年的经验告诉我:
憋出来的代码,往往毫无价值,迟早会在日后哪天重新检视时,被自己大刀阔斧地大段大段地删除掉,忍痛重构。
如此看来,无所事事的过程,可能就是在默想当中,一遍又一遍重构的过程。
其实说到底吧:懒——就一个字!我居然能写出这么睿智、这么风骚的一大堆话来,安慰自己,不得不佩服自己的文采与厚脸皮。
哈哈哈哈。